Jalapeno Lime Chicken

Course Main Course
Cuisine American
Servings 4

Ingredients
  

  • 1/2 cup orange juice concentrate
  • 1/3 cup white onion finely chopped
  • 1 squeezed lime
  • 1/4 cup honey
  • 1/2 jalapeno pepper sliced and seeded
  • 1 tsp ground cumin
  • 1 tsp grated lime peel
  • 1/4 tsp garlic salt
  • 1 garlic cloves minced
  • 6 boneless skinless breast halves

Instructions
 

  • In a 4 cup measuring cup combine the first 9 ingredients.
  • Pour 2 cups into a gallon Ziploc storage bag and turn to coat.
  • Refrigerate for 2-4 hours
  • Coat grill with cooking spray and preheat grill to medium heat.
  • Drain and discard marinade from chicken.
  • Grill chicken, covered, over medium heat.

Notes

Always use a meat thermometer when cooking meat. 
The safe temperature for grilled chicken, according to the USDA, is 165 degrees F or 74 degrees C. This temperature ensures that any harmful bacteria, like Salmonella, are killed.
